One, Come Down to the Store, Minerva, appeared in the horror anthology Shadow Masters: An Anthology From the Horror Zone and was inspired by an idea Hamner said he had stashed away decades before when he was writing for The Twilight Zone. He soon left, however, first to attend Northwestern University in Evanston, Illinois, and then the University of Cincinnati, where he studied radio. Earl worked in the summer painting dorms and was a dispatcher for The Brooks Transportation Company during the school year to help pay his expenses. The eldest of eight red-haired children in a poor, Baptist family, Earl Henry Hamner Jr. was born July 10, 1923, in Schuyler, Va., a mining and milling village in the foothills of the Blue Ridge . He had decided to become a writer at age 6, however, after getting a poem published on the children's page of a Richmond, Va., newspaper. I ran into one of the young editors on the show who had been a trainee on The Waltons and I said, I know a nice old guy who would love to write an episode for you. Rocky said, Ill speak to my boss. A few days later he called and apologized and said, Im embarrassed to say this, but they dont want any of the old writers on the new show. I was sorry to be rejected, but in view of the lackluster revival they could have used some of us old hands.. Would I like to write them up like little plays? I thanked Buck and told him I would write them up like little films, which I did.
